The Cardiovascular S Approximator Clamp Frame 1.0 2.25mm is a premium microvascular surgical instrument engineered to facilitate precise vessel approximation and temporary vascular occlusion during cardiovascular, vascular, and reconstructive microsurgical procedures. Specifically designed for blood vessels measuring 1.0mm to 2.25mm in diameter, this specialized clamp frame securely aligns vessel ends while maintaining a stable, bloodless operative field for delicate vascular anastomosis. It is an indispensable instrument for surgeons performing complex vascular repairs where precision, atraumatic handling, and dependable vessel stabilization are essential.
Accurate vessel approximation plays a critical role in successful vascular reconstruction. The Cardiovascular S Approximator Clamp Frame 1.0–2.25mm is designed to hold both vessel ends securely in proper alignment throughout the anastomotic procedure, minimizing vessel movement and improving microsurgical accuracy. By maintaining temporary blood flow occlusion and optimal vessel positioning, the instrument enhances surgical visibility, simplifies suture placement, and contributes to consistent, high-quality anastomotic outcomes.
Designed specifically for vessels ranging from 1.0mm to 2.25mm, the clamp frame incorporates finely engineered atraumatic jaws that distribute pressure evenly across the vessel wall. This balanced compression effectively interrupts blood flow while helping preserve endothelial integrity and minimizing the risk of intimal injury, vessel deformation, or unnecessary tissue trauma. The precision clamping mechanism provides reliable stabilization without excessive compression, supporting safe handling of delicate vascular structures.
